
Gerald E. “Jerry” Glenzer, age 92, passed away on February 20, 2021, at Rocky Knoll Health Care
Facility in where he had been a resident for the past three years.
He was born on August 30, 1928 a son of the late William and Nellie (Cudworth) Glenzer.
Jerry served his country in the United States Navy.
On June 20, 1970 he married Caroline Damrow in Waukegan, IL. The couple has resided in the Town
of Mitchell for 23 years, the Town of Osceola for 15 years, then in Cascade. They enjoyed fishing and
gardening together. Caroline preceded him in death on April 15, 2013.
He worked at many different jobs throughout his life including: building mobile homes,
painting water towers, woodworking, and was employed at the Armstrong School, and was the
caretaker of the Camp Vista Boy Scout Camp in the Town of Osceola for several years.
Jerry enjoyed watching old western movies, cheering on the Green Bay Packers and the
Milwaukee Brewers and loved telling stories about his life. He also loved to make things out of wood and
loved to tease people and would go out of his way to help anyone in need.
